We are looking for:

The Key Account Manager (KAM) will be responsible for the overall growth and strategic development of key account(s). The KAM, based in North America, coordinates all communication and oversees all short term projects and long term strategic priorities for the account(s).
The KAM is responsible for managing an existing base & developing new business. This includes gathering business information, developing commercial tactical plans, and executing these plans in order to generate expanded growth for the company.

We can count on you to:
  • Build and maintain strong relationships through proactive communication and regular visits to discuss existing business & commercial opportunities in targeted applications.
  • Grow Sales/ICM and deliver budget delivery
  • Act as a key contact point for customers and educate them on products, applications, and trends.
  • Achieve KPI objectives according to global marketing & pricing strategy, as well as commercial guidelines
  • Design and update the Key Account Plan (KAP) as needed
  • Drive innovation and facilitate product launches
  • Maintain and continuously improve knowledge about products, applications and markets in the industry
  • Develop, negotiate, and monitor contracts and pricing for new & existing business opportunities
  • Evaluate and propose innovative solutions for customer problems and coordinate with internal resources (R&I, etc.) when needed to meet customer requests/demands and ensure issues are resolved
You will bring:
  • BS/BA preferred in a chemical or associated field
  • MBA a plus
  • 8 or more years of experience in the Home & Personal Care Market . 10 years preferred
  • Strong Hunter mentality
  • Strong track record of growing business while managing and growing large, complex accounts
  • Ability to educate customers/colleagues both on the technical and commercial aspect of our portfolio and communicate in a succinct and compelling way
  • Excellent initiative, autonomy and enthusiasm
  • Demonstrated track record of successful sales/negotiations, key account management/business development and internal/external relationships at multiple levels within the organization.
  • Strong desire to share knowledge
  • Ability to influence and forge strong relationships with impact at any level in the customer organization or in the Global Business Unit
  • Experience and ability to work in a global matrix
  • Technical knowledge of formulation, surfactants and polymers
  • Excellent project coordination and team building skills
  • Demonstrated ability to make decisions under minimum supervision; occasionally makes decisions of a complex nature within operating guidelines

About Us
  • Syensqo is a science company developing groundbreaking solutions that enhance the way we live, work, travel and play. Inspired by the scientific councils which Ernest Solvay initiated in 1911, we bring great minds together to push the limits of science and innovation for the benefit of our customers, with a diverse, global team of more than 13,000 associates. Our solutions contribute to safer, cleaner, and more sustainable products found in homes, food and consumer goods, planes, cars, batteries, smart devices and health care applications. Our innovation power enables us to deliver on the ambition of a circular economy and explore breakthrough technologies that advance humanity.
